A Closer Look at Door Closer Installation
Installing a lock correctly is about far more than screwing on a piece of hardware. The bore has to be the right size, the backset has to match, the strike must align with the bolt, and the whole assembly has to sit flush so the door closes and locks without a fight. Small mistakes here are why so many doors 'stick' or fail to lock a year later.
We take the time to measure, prep, and align every installation properly, then cycle the lock repeatedly to confirm it operates smoothly from both sides. The result is hardware that not only looks right but keeps working reliably for years, not months.
